The lyrics of the song "Baiya" by Delphic depict a sense of chaos, tension, and conflict. The lyrics suggest a dystopian atmosphere where the city is burning, and jackals are crawling. The repeated line "All hell is breaking loose" further emphasizes the chaotic and destructive nature of the depicted world.

The lines "I'm not a saint, but you're a sin, I can feel you creeping" convey a sense of unease and suspicion. The protagonist feels the presence of someone or something that is unsettling and potentially dangerous. This presence is described as a sin, highlighting its negative and harmful nature.

The chorus contains the line "Tenderness is the only weapon left, I comfort you," suggesting that amidst the chaos, the protagonist finds solace and strength in showing kindness and compassion. In a world filled with violence and conflict, the power of tenderness becomes an essential tool for survival and connection.

The mention of the wolf and the idea of playing a broken game could symbolize deceit and manipulation. The protagonist warns against closing one's eyes and continuing to dream without being aware of the consequences.

Overall, the lyrics of "Baiya" paint a bleak picture of a world in turmoil and highlight the importance of remaining compassionate and tender-hearted amidst the chaos. It serves as a reminder to stay vigilant and adaptable in the face of adversity.
